The coast of Sant Feliu de Guíxols is full of contrasts: in the middle of cliffs, there are splendid coves, some rocky and others of fine sand. From the south we can highlight 'cala Canyerets', 'cala Vigatà' and 'Port Salvi', among others, until reaching the bay of Sant Feliu. To the north, the beach of 'Sant Pol' preserves the beauty of the 19th century buildings and clear, calm and shallow waters.
The marina, commercial and fishing port, which allows the entry of large ships into the bay, is the nexus of the city with its seafaring origins, the result of a very close relationship with the Mediterranean that has endured to the present day. A walk to the lighthouse on the quay reflects the link between Sant Feliu de Guíxols and the sea in the form of a panoramic view.
